Mobility Scooter Benefits and Drawbacks
Mobility scooters enable those with limited mobility to get within their communities and homes. These scooters have a seat that is mounted on four, three, or more wheels. The feet are set on a flat surface, and the handlebars control the steering.

Reduced Physical Strain
Mobility scooters are a frequent sight on the streets providing freedom and better quality of life for those with limited mobility. While it is easy to recognize the advantages of these vehicles, it is essential to take into consideration some of the disadvantages that be associated with them.
The main benefit of mobility scooters is that they aid in reducing the physical strain often caused by walking, particularly over long distances or uneven surfaces. This is especially beneficial for those who struggle with arthritis because it can prevent discomfort and inflammation caused by overexertion.
Mobility scooters are also more comfortable and stable than walking. This makes them a great option for those who have balance issues or those who are at risk of falling. Additionally, the majority of scooters are equipped with safety features to prevent injuries in the event that the vehicle is involved in an accident.
One drawback of mobility scooters is their dependence on batteries to power the vehicle and provide the user with a means to travel. Therefore, it is crucial to maintain the battery properly and in accordance with the manufacturer's guidelines regarding charging and discharging cycles. This can extend the lifespan of the battery and also prevent possible breakdowns.
Mobility scooters can be difficult to transport. Some models will require dismantling or folded to fit into the trunk of a car. Some are heavy and bulky and require a ramp or lift to load them into a vehicle.

Enhanced Social Interaction

Mobility scooters can give the feeling of empowerment to users as they can complete errands and activities without relying on other people. The ability to connect with their communities and explore new surroundings despite physical limitations has been shown to significantly enhance the quality of life. This can be especially beneficial for seniors who struggle with feelings of loneliness and a lack of self-esteem when they remain in their homes.
Many scooters have features that enhance security and stability, allowing users feel secure while using the device. This can make them more willing to venture outdoors and participate in social activities, reducing the risk of depression or anxiety. The increased security of a scooter can also reduce the chance of falls and accidents, which are common among the older population and can result in serious consequences.
Mobility scooters are versatile and can be used to accomplish many tasks, including shopping or trips out with your friends. Studies have revealed that scooter users utilize their devices three to five days each week. Most trips are local to the destination (Barton, et al. 2014). Some scooters might have difficulty getting into buildings due to their size and the radius of their turning however, this issue is usually mitigated by an elevator or lift which is usually found in the newer public buildings.
Mobility scooters are also more suitable for outdoor activities since they cover a wider range of terrains than wheelchairs. For example, some scooters have a robust suspension system and larger wheels, which enable them to go over grassy areas or uneven sidewalks without difficulty. This flexibility lets users take scenic drives or walk tours in their preferred cities regardless of their physical limitations.

There are a number of different types of mobility scooters on the market to suit a variety of needs. If you are looking to purchase one, it is crucial to talk to your doctor about the type of scooter that is suitable for you. You should also inquire with your insurance provider to determine whether they can assist you with the cost. In the US mobility scooters are regarded as durable medical equipment. the full details may be covered with a prescription from your doctor.
